#DC218C Color Information
#DC218C is a dark color. The closest websafe version is #DC218C. A complement of this color would be #21DE73, perceived brightness is 0.40, and the grayscale version is #7F7F7F.
In the HSL color space, this color has a hue angle of 326°,a saturation of 74%, and a lightness of 50%.The HSV representation shows a hue of 326°, a saturation of 85%, and a value of 86%.
In a RGB color space, #DC218C is composed of 86% red, 13% green and 55%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 85% magenta, 36% yellow and 14% black.
In the Yxy color space, this color is represented as Y: 18.60, x: 0.4803, and y: 0.2513.
